#a68344 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a68344 is composed of 65.1% red, 51.4%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.1% magenta, 59%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 38.6 degrees, a saturation of 41.9% and a lightness of 45.9%. #a68344 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ff88 with #4d0700.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

● #a68344 color description : Dark moderate orange.
#a68344 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a68344 has RGB values of R:166, G:131,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0.59,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10912580.

Shades and Tints of #a68344
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0a05 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a68344
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797671 is the less saturated color, while #e59505 is the most saturated one.
